Factors Affecting Cost
- Material Type: Different materials like concrete, brick, or pavers have varying costs.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ates can significantly impact the overall cost.
- Extent of Damage: The severity of the damage will determine the amount of work required.
- Permits and Inspections: Costs for necessary permits and inspections by local authorities.
- Accessibility: The ease of access to the restoration site can affect labor and equipment costs.
- Project Size: Larger projects may benefit from economies of scale, reducing the per-unit cost.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Red Oak, TX) |
---|---|
Concrete Sidewalk Repair | $6 - $10 per square foot |
Brick Sidewalk Restoration | $10 - $20 per square foot |
Paver Sidewalk Installation | $15 - $25 per square foot |
Tree Root Removal | $100 - $500 per tree |
Permit Fees | $50 - $200 |
Inspection Fees | $100 - $300 |
Demolition and Removal | $2 - $5 per square foot |
Leveling and Grading | $1 - $3 per square foot |
